LinkedIn Pinpoint 660 answer proof
| Clue | Answer fit | Why it works |
|---|---|---|
| Trade | Trade union | Trade (Trade + Union): An organized association of workers formed to protect their rights |
| Credit | Credit union | Credit (Credit + Union): A member-owned financial cooperative |
| Rugby | Rugby union | Rugby (Rugby + Union): One of the two major codes of rugby football |
| Western | Western union | Western (Western + Union): A financial services and communications company |
| European (27 members) | European union | European (European + Union): A political and economic union of 27 member states |

Look for words that can precede a common term. When clues seem unrelated, try finding a single word they could all modify.
Pay attention to numerical hints. The '27 members' detail was a strong indicator for European Union.
Consider institutional and organizational terms. Many common compound phrases relate to organizations or institutions.
